The Apple iPhone 8, iPhone 8 Plus and iPhone X all now support Qi wireless charging. So cool! But are all Qi chargers the same? Tech expert Dave Taylor of https://www.AskDaveTaylor.com/ tried out the Belkin Boost Up Qi Charger for the iPhone and his findings may surprise you... If you have a new iPhone X or either of the iPhone 8 line and you're not taking advantage of Qi charging, by the way, you're definitely missing out on something very cool...
